Hardwood is wood that comes from broad leaf trees or two that produce nuts. Walnut, Maple and Cherry trees are the ones that are used mist frequently in North America. The climate in North America is perfect for the trees so they grow in great abundance. Lumber from any of these trees is labeled hardwood.
However, this generic label is somewhat misleading because there are major differences in the types. Industrials groups have worked hard to give rating to various lumbers to help differentiate between them. Different strengths and grades are defined to let consumers know which ones are the hardest and which are soft. Knowing the difference between the grades is extremely important because it should be taken into account when choosing which wood will be used for which applications.
The hardest hardwoods are hickory and Pecan. Hardness is measured by how many pounds if pressure it takes to mar the wood. These two woods require about 1,820 pounds of pressure to mar them.
